Transaction 02af7515dca92dc6354b53f000b8f3ccfe709e7719800e125fe748aaab668b18
1 Input
1 Output
-
02af7515dca92dc6354b53f000b8f3ccfe709e7719800e125fe748aaab668b18:0
- value
- 378859
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 421e7f8e77b5bf0194edcfc42717ee3498e2d0c9 OP_EQUAL
- address
- 37id4G7RSecmDKFFYCHmdKEhZeGE2mrP4u